In 2019-2020, 13,176 people earned their degree in fire protection, making the major the 114th most popular in the United States. In 2017-2018, fire protection gra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$51,404 and had an average of $24,230 in loans still to pay off.

Across Oklahoma, there were 200 fire protection gra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$24,980 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 50 fire protection gra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Oklahoma State University - Main Campus.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Fire Protection Schools for a Bachelor’s in Oklahoma For Those Getting Aid list. Oklahoma State University - Main Campus is located in Stillwater, Oklahoma and, has a large student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 50 bachelors’s fire protection degrees to qualified students.

In addition to being on our oklahoma bachelor’s degree fire protection students with aid list, OSU has also earned the #1 rank in our “Best Fire Protection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Oklahoma” ranking. The yearly cost to attend OSU is $14,648 for oklahoma bachelor’s degree fire protection students with aid.

The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 85%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.
